I was in Duxford at the airshow in 26th May 2013, however there were much less planes - no P-38, no Corsair, no I-15, no 109 (Buchón only) and so on...

Do they bring planes out of UK for that airshow?

They invite warbirds from all over the world. I saw lots of American birds in that video and Redbull's P-38 (Austria) and Norwegian Dakota. Obviously everybody can't make it every year. Black 6, the desert camoed 109G you saw in the video crashed and is not longer airworthy, but there are other DB powered 109s these days.

I was in Duxford at the airshow in 26th May 2013, however there were much less planes - no P-38, no Corsair, no I-15, no 109 (Buchón only) and so on...

Do they bring planes out of UK for that airshow?

only just seen this thread,  You must have went to the spring airshow (70th D-day anniversary airshow next weekend).   Flying Legends is solely WW2 era prop planes and is usually 2nd weekend in July.
